
Python Считайте два целых числа – стороны прямоугольника a× b. Если этот прямоугольник является
квадратом, то выведите на экран его площадь. Иначе выведите на экран периметр прямоугольника.

Ответы на вопрос

Ответ:
a = int (input ("Введите а " ))
b = int (input ("Введите b " ))
if a==b:
print ("S= ", a*b)
else:
print ("P= ", 2*(a+b))



Объяснение:
a=int(input())
b=int(input())
if a==b:
print("Площадь квадрата:",a**2)
if a!=b:
print("Периметр прямоугольника:",(a+b)*2)



Для решения данной задачи в Python, можно использовать следующий код:
a = int(input("Введите значение стороны a: ")) b = int(input("Введите значение стороны b: "))
if a == b: # Если стороны a и b равны, то это квадрат square_area = a * b print("Площадь квадрата:", square_area) else: # Если стороны a и b не равны, то это прямоугольник rectangle_perimeter = 2 * (a + b) print("Периметр прямоугольника:", rectangle_perimeter)
В этом коде мы сначала считываем значения сторон прямоугольника, используя функцию input(). Затем, с помощью условного оператора if, проверяем, является ли прямоугольник квадратом. Если стороны a и b равны, то выводим на экран площадь квадрата, которая вычисляется как произведение сторон. Если стороны не равны, то выводим на экран периметр прямоугольника, который вычисляется как удвоенная сумма сторон.


Похожие вопросы
Топ вопросов за вчера в категории Информатика







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ili